Thermal insulated steel pipes are an important component in modern construction and building projects, particularly in systems requiring efficient temperature control. These pipes are designed to reduce heat loss or gain during the transportation of fluids, making them ideal for heating, cooling, and plumbing applications. The insulation around the steel pipes serves as a barrier, maintaining the desired temperature of the fluids inside while minimizing energy costs and enhancing overall energy efficiency.
One of the primary advantages of thermal insulated steel pipes is their ability to reduce energy consumption. By limiting thermal exchange with the surrounding environment, these pipes help maintain the temperature of fluids being transported. This is especially crucial in heating, ventilation, and air conditioning (HVAC) systems, where energy efficiency is paramount. By minimizing heat loss in hot water systems or preventing condensation in chilled water systems, these pipes can lead to substantial savings over time.
Furthermore, thermal insulated steel pipes contribute to the longevity of the piping system. By providing a protective layer against environmental factors and temperature fluctuations, the insulation helps prevent corrosion and degradation of the steel. This durability translates to lower maintenance costs and longer service life, making them a worthwhile investment in any construction project.
In addition to energy efficiency and durability, these insulated pipes offer versatility in application. They can be utilized in various settings, including residential, commercial, and industrial projects. Whether for plumbing, process piping, or district heating systems, thermal insulated steel pipes can be adapted to meet specific needs.
When considering supply options for thermal insulated steel pipes, it’s essential to evaluate the quality of materials and the expertise of the suppliers. Look for suppliers who can provide detailed information about insulation types, such as polyurethane and fiberglass, as well as their thermal performance characteristics. Understanding the insulation's R-value, which measures thermal resistance, is critical for ensuring optimal performance.
Moreover, regulatory compliance is an essential factor to consider when selecting thermal insulated steel pipes. Different regions may have specific building codes and standards related to insulation and energy efficiency. Suppliers should be knowledgeable about these standards, ensuring that the materials they provide meet or exceed local requirements.
